Poelau Laut |
The ship was built in 1929 in Amsterdam, Netherlands and had served, in the interim, to handle cargo between Europe and the Dutch East Indies. For the time she was built her speed of 15 knots must have been very satisfactory for that trade. The ship had five cargo holds and gear for handling miscellaneous cargo utilizing a lot of longshoremen. The Poelau Laut had been designed to handle about thirty passengers on its voyages to the Dutch East Indies. The passengers, who must have lived a unhurried life of leisure, occupying small but comfortable staterooms. They had a spacious lounge where they could read, smoke and play cards. The dining room, as well, was spacious for the number of people on the passenger list. |
